Bryn Kenney just reached a new personal high after knocking out Daniel Rauta. After a raise to 16,000 Kenney decided to call from the cutoff. Rauta was sitting in the small blind and he called all in for less than the raise.
The flop brought out and both players checked. On the turn the hit and Kenney's opponent check-folded to his 29,000-chip bet.
Kenny showed and Rauta was in bad shape with . The river brought the and Rauta was knocked out.

Ronny Voth raised to 12,000 from the hijack and Roman Korenev three-bet to 30,000 from the button. The action was folded back to Voth who made the call after which the flop rolled out .
Voth check-called 49,000 and the turn brought the . Voth checked once more and now Korenev bet 74,000. Voth tanked again and called after which the river brought the . This time Voth check-folded to a 126,000-chip bet and Korenev took down this big pot.

Sebastian Trisch opened to 12,000 from early position and action folded around to the table to Pratyush Buddiga in the cutoff. Buddiga three-bet to 28,800 and it folded back to Trisch who called.
The flop brought and Trisch checked. Buddiga continued out for 26,000 and Trisch stuck around. The hit the turn and Trisch checked again. Buddiga checked it back and the fell on the river. Two more checks prompted Buddiga to table .
Trisch mucked his hand and Buddiga took down the pot. He's now sitting on 725,000.
